Pacific Beach Kiwanians honor three fifth graders
Students recognized for leadership and being role models to peers
Published on Feb. 25,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
The Pacific Beach Kiwanis Club has honored three fifth grade students from local schools as part of its 'Student of the Month' recognition program for the 2025-26 school year. The honorees were Harper Eaves from Crown Point Junior Music Academy, Leona Khalifa from Pacific Beach Elementary, and Isabelle Smith from Kate Sessions Elementary.
Why it matters
The Kiwanis Club's student recognition program aims to encourage and celebrate leadership and positive role modeling among elementary school students in the Pacific Beach community.
The details
Each of the three students received a certificate and $25 in 'Mr. Frostie' dollars, which were donated by a local business. The club also hosted the students, their families, and teachers for a special breakfast. The students were nominated by their teachers for exhibiting strong leadership skills and being good role models to their peers.
